My car shifts ok...a little notchy, maybe. But, I don't know what fluid is in it, or how long it's been in there (obviously, it's new to me). So, replacing tranny and rear diff fluid this weekend...I'm going with the Redline 50/50 mix for the Tranny and MT 90 for the rear diff. Originally Posted by JeboMadera
I just bought my 2003 touring few weeks ago. I noticed this noise you're talking about few days ago. I thought it was the throw out bearing. Maybe its just normal for the tranny?
It's normal. It has a chattery sound at idle. I've noticed when it's cold it has a different almost howling type noise but when the oil gets warmed up that goes away.
